CIQ

Cloud Bursting

May 31, 2023

What Is Cloud Bursting?

Cloud bursting allows businesses to manage their infrastructure by automatically accessing additional cloud resources when there is an unexpected or temporary spike in demand for computing resources. With cloud bursting, businesses can scale their infrastructure quickly and cost-effectively without the need to maintain additional resources.

This method is particularly useful for organizations that experience significant variations in demand for their services, such as e-commerce companies during the holiday season. By using cloud bursting, organizations can ensure that they are able to handle peak workloads or seasonal surges while keeping costs low. Overall, cloud bursting is an effective way to ensure that businesses have the necessary resources to meet the demands of their customers while keeping costs under control.

Why Is Cloud Bursting Important?

Cloud bursting is important for organizations because it allows them to easily and quickly expand their infrastructure when there is a sudden increase in demand for computing resources. This means that organizations can avoid the cost and complexity of maintaining and managing their own physical infrastructure that may go underutilized during periods of low demand.

In addition, cloud bursting enables businesses to provide their customers with high-quality services, even during periods of peak demand. By seamlessly accessing additional cloud resources, they can ensure that their applications and services remain responsive and reliable, without incurring any downtime or service disruptions. Cloud bursting is a flexible, cost-effective, and reliable solution that enables businesses to meet the ever-changing demands of their customers in an efficient and effective manner.

How Does Cloud Bursting Work?

Below is an explanation of how cloud bursting works:

  1. Cloud bursting relies on a hybrid cloud infrastructure, which combines a private cloud environment with one or more public cloud environments.

  2. When the demand for computing resources exceeds the capacity of the private cloud environment, the cloud bursting mechanism automatically provisions additional resources from the public cloud environment(s).

  3. The cloud bursting mechanism typically uses pre-defined policies to determine when and how additional resources should be provisioned. These policies may take into account factors such as the current workload, the cost of additional resources, and the desired service level objectives.

  4. Once additional resources have been provisioned, the cloud bursting mechanism distributes the workload across the private and public cloud environments, enabling the application or service to handle the increased demand seamlessly.

  5. When the demand for resources returns to normal levels, the cloud bursting mechanism automatically releases the additional resources and returns the workload to the private cloud environment.

How Can Organizations Implement Cloud Bursting Effectively?

Organizations can implement cloud bursting effectively by following these best practices:

  • Set clear goals and policies - Before implementing cloud bursting, organizations should clearly define their goals and objectives, and develop policies that specify when and how additional resources should be provisioned. For example, policies may be based on metrics such as CPU utilization, network bandwidth, or storage capacity.

  • Choose the right cloud provider(s) - To ensure effective cloud bursting, organizations should carefully select their cloud providers based on factors like reliability, performance, and cost. Ideally, the providers should offer a range of complementary services that can be seamlessly integrated with the organization's existing infrastructure.

  • Optimize the workload distribution - To maximize the benefits of cloud bursting, organizations should optimize the distribution of their workloads across private and public cloud environments. This may involve using workload management tools that monitor and dynamically adjust the allocation of resources based on current demand.

As an example, consider an e-commerce company that experiences a surge in traffic during the holiday season. To handle this increased demand, the company could implement cloud bursting by using a hybrid cloud infrastructure that combines its existing private cloud with a public cloud provider such as Amazon Web Services or Microsoft Azure. The company could then set policies to automatically provision additional resources from the public cloud when the demand for computing resources exceeds the capacity of its private cloud. By optimizing the workload distribution and selecting the right cloud providers, the company could effectively scale its infrastructure to handle the increased traffic, while avoiding the cost and complexity of maintaining additional resources during the rest of the year.